A stone's throw from the Cours Sextius, this garden is a haven of peace where you can relax along shady paths scented with roses near the orangery. Part of the park is laid out in the French style in front of the 17th-century Pavillon de Vendôme, commissioned by Louis de Mercœur, Duc de Vendôme, to house his secret love affair with Lucrèce de Forbin, "la belle du Canet". Now the town's museum, exhibitions and events are held here from time to time.
